Brooches are back – and they’re cooler than ever. Once thought of as accessories for vintage enthusiasts or your grandmother’s jewelry box, brooches are now making a huge comeback on modern runways and street style scenes. With the right styling, brooches can look incredibly fresh, edgy, and fashion-forward. Here are five ways to wear brooches without looking old-fashioned.

1. Pin Them on Unexpected Places

Forget the traditional lapel pinning. Modern style is all about using brooches creatively:

  • On a Belt: Cinch your waist by adding a brooch to your belt buckle for a surprising twist.
  • On Your Hat: Jazz up a fedora, beanie, or wide-brim hat with a shiny brooch.
  • On Boots or Sneakers: Attach a brooch to the side of your footwear for an edgy, customized look.
  • On Your Bag: Pin a brooch to your crossbody or tote bag for a stylish accessory upgrade.

Using brooches in unexpected places instantly modernizes the look and adds an element of surprise. A brooch on the brim of a hat, for example, can give off a playful, offbeat vibe perfect for festivals, while a brooch on boots transforms them into statement pieces. Don’t be afraid to think outside the box — the more unconventional, the fresher it looks.

2. Layer with Other Jewelry

Think of your brooch as part of a larger jewelry story. Layer it with necklaces, earrings, and rings for a cohesive, maximalist look:

  • Pair a bold brooch with chunky gold chains.
  • Match gemstone-studded brooches with colorful statement rings.
  • Mix different metal tones (gold, silver, rose gold) for a contemporary vibe.

Layering gives your overall style depth and prevents the brooch from feeling too “singular” or old-fashioned. Imagine wearing a brooch surrounded by layers of delicate necklaces or bangles – it becomes part of an ensemble, not an isolated vintage piece. Layered jewelry styling embraces modern eclecticism, making the look feel curated and current.

3. Use Multiple Brooches at Once

Instead of wearing just one, cluster several brooches together. Create shapes, trails, or a constellation across your jacket, blazer, or even a plain sweater. Mixing different sizes, shapes, and styles makes the look curated, eclectic, and modern.

Tips for brooch clustering:

  • Stick to a color palette for cohesion.
  • Vary sizes for visual interest.
  • Create intentional patterns rather than random placement.

For instance, you can arrange several small floral brooches to create a “bouquet” effect on the shoulder of a blazer, or arrange metallic star-shaped pins to mimic a galaxy pattern on a dark denim jacket. This approach feels youthful, artsy, and highly Instagram-worthy.

4. Style with Minimalist Outfits

Brooches pop best when styled against clean, minimalist fashion. Think plain white shirts, black blazers, simple jumpsuits, or monochrome dresses. Let the brooch become the focal point of an otherwise pared-down look.

  • A sleek black turtleneck with a single sparkling brooch at the shoulder.
  • A minimalist linen dress adorned with a botanical or animal-themed brooch.
  • A plain neutral tote accented with a vivid gemstone pin.

The contrast between minimalism and intricate brooch design creates an intentional, stylish balance. Minimalist outfits give brooches the perfect blank canvas to shine. They look artistic rather than stuffy, bold rather than old-fashioned.

5. Pick Modern Designs

Choosing the right brooch makes all the difference. Skip overly ornate vintage styles unless you’re deliberately creating a vintage-modern mix.

Look for:

  • Geometric shapes
  • Abstract art-inspired designs
  • Bold, clean lines
  • Eco-friendly or upcycled materials
  • Playful motifs like planets, fruits, or contemporary florals

Modern brooches made from sustainable materials such as recycled metals or lab-grown gemstones also align with current trends toward eco-conscious fashion. Brands are increasingly creating brooches from upcycled vintage pieces, making them both stylish and environmentally responsible.

Bonus: Combine Brooches with Modern Outerwear

Pinning a brooch on a leather jacket, denim vest, bomber, or trench coat instantly updates the traditional brooch aesthetic. Brooches on denim jackets, in particular, offer a cool, streetwear-approved vibe that’s completely fresh.

Imagine:

  • A cluster of metallic pins on the chest pocket of a distressed denim jacket.
  • A sleek, minimalistic brooch pinned to the collar of a neutral trench coat.
  • A gemstone-studded piece sparkling against the tough texture of a black leather biker jacket.

The juxtaposition between traditional “delicate” brooches and “tough” modern outerwear is what makes the style feel innovative.

Eco-Friendly Brooch Choices

Sustainability is an important part of modern fashion. Choosing eco-conscious brooches enhances your style and values:

  • Upcycled Jewelry: Designers are transforming antique brooches into new, fresh designs.
  • Recycled Metals: Many brands use recycled silver or gold to create new brooches.
  • Lab-Grown Gemstones: These reduce environmental impact compared to mined stones.
  • Handcrafted Pieces: Supporting artisans ensures ethical production and promotes sustainable livelihoods.

Look for certifications or shop from brands committed to responsible practices.

Tips for Caring for Modern Brooches

To keep your brooches looking sharp and stylish:

  • Store Properly: Keep brooches in separate pouches to avoid scratching.
  • Clean Gently: Use a soft cloth; avoid harsh chemicals.
  • Secure Fastenings: Always check that clasps and pins are secure before wearing.
  • Be Gentle on Fabric: Heavy brooches can damage delicate materials; choose placement wisely.

With a little care, a beautiful brooch can become a timeless accessory in your wardrobe.
